Introduction

The Bently Nevada 31000-16-10-00-156-00-02 proximity probe housing is a mechanically engineered mounting solution developed to ensure long-term stability of 31000 series proximity probes. In rotating machinery monitoring, the housing plays a decisive role by preserving probe alignment and minimizing structural influence on measurement signals. This model is intended for continuous-duty industrial applications where reliability, repeatability, and mechanical integrity are critical to machinery protection strategies.

Technical FAQs

  1. What is the primary purpose of this proximity probe housing?
    It secures and stabilizes the proximity probe to ensure accurate vibration and displacement measurements.

  2. Is this housing specific to the 31000 series probes?
    Yes, it is designed exclusively for Bently Nevada 31000 series proximity probes.

  3. Why is housing rigidity important in vibration monitoring systems?
    Rigid mounting prevents probe movement that could introduce signal errors.

  4. Can this housing be used in continuous-duty machinery?
    Yes, it is engineered for long-term operation under constant mechanical load.

  5. Which types of machinery typically use this housing?
    Turbines, compressors, pumps, motors, and other rotating equipment.

  6. Does the housing influence measurement accuracy?
    Yes, stable probe positioning directly affects signal accuracy and repeatability.

  7. Is it suitable for high-vibration industrial environments?
    It is specifically designed to maintain alignment under severe vibration conditions.

  8. Does it integrate easily with existing Bently Nevada systems?
    Yes, it follows standard mounting practices used across Bently Nevada platforms.

  9. Are special tools required for installation?
    No, standard industrial installation tools are sufficient.

  10. How does this housing support predictive maintenance programs?
    By ensuring consistent sensor positioning, it enables reliable long-term trend analysis.
